Tips to Have an Awesome and Future-Proof Website
Online hoaxes and data
breaching are not new for the internet world. Therefore, while building the
website it's extremely crucial to make it highly secure. But there are many
other points to keep in mind while developing websites that are ready for future
years.
There is no easy formula to guarantee your future-proof website. Though, there are few tips to follow to create awesome and future proof
website.
1. Analyze and Draw a Blueprint
When you construct your website, consider a two-year future plan for
the online presence. Things will change surely, but if you have a deeply
analyzed plan about the future of your website you can discuss it with your
graphic designer. It will help you to find the best solution for not only now,
but also for the future and ultimately reduce the development costs.
2. Invest in relationships:
Try hard to keep the same team for your website, at least the
service provider and graphic designer. Owning a strong web designer for your
website will help you to save a lot of money. Turning from one web designer to
another can disrupt your budget. Therefore, choose someone who is an expert in
what he does and invest in long term relationship with him.
3. Use Cloud:
Don’t get confused about regular backups and upgrades for your
website system. Build a backup on the cloud for the emergency situation. In
case your code gets damaged, you have a backup on the cloud, so you don’t have
to begin all over again. Moreover, there other many benefits of using the cloud
for business websites.
4. Invest in improvements:
Need not to burn a hole in your pocket, rather always keep some
budget for improvements always. Always create a website that is easy to
redesign in the future. Set a solid association, so you can consistently build
your website. Always remember the website demands regular changes,
therefore save funds from your budget for future upgrades of the website.
5. Build a responsive website:
Mobile-friendly websites bring huge traffic, as a high percentage
of customers are using mobile phones for any tasks. A responsively designed
website with mobile-friendly version is more likely to please users in the long
run and increase traffic. This shows that no website can neglect the value of
mobile website design in the current or coming years despite the size of the
business.
6.Implement code that can be easily updated:
If you need your website to be easily squeezed and respond more
efficiently to your future audience, then you require to establish a codebase
that is simple to maintain and change.
An easy code is easy to access and modify thus helps in the
complete growth of your website. A complicated code will restrict your website
from future change, therefore, you have to begin all over again.
7. Work with a trusted Content Management System:
When working the Content Management
System (CMS) for your website,
find the best solution that has the capacity to develop as per the needs. Some
CMS providers in the market charge loads of extra money for using their
platform. WordPress is the most trusted and broadly used Content Management
System. Be very cautious while choosing the CMS for your website and select the
one that is reliable and can be used for the future years.
8. Create SEO friendly website
Keeping your website SEO-friendly is very essential to rank on
Google’s first pages. A complete set of meta tags, title, URL, keyword
research, on-page, and off-page SEO results in SEO-friendly website. It
will encourage search engines to crawl every page on your website and index in
their database.
9. Always choose manageable designs:
Building a website with a simple and minimal theme is one of the
best approaches to use it for years with distinction. Instead of going with the
inclinations, maintain the overall look of your website and feature an engaging
user experience that sparks audience interests, and enhance lead generation.
10. Post Relatable content:
An organization that has excel in the content marketing profits
revenue which is six times greater than the one who doesn’t incorporate content
marketing practices on its website. A website with appropriate content can keep
the visitors for a more extended period of time. Therefore, design a website
that remains value-added for the future. Constantly update your pre-existing
content and monitor the quality of links on the website.
